Album Description
"Minecraft - Volume Beta" is the second soundtrack album by German electronic musician Daniel Rosenfeld, better known as C418. Released on November 9, 2013, this album is a sprawling collection of tracks that were added to the Java Edition of the popular video game Minecraft during its music update. Spanning over two hours and twenty minutes, it is C418's longest batch of music to date, featuring a diverse range of electronic compositions that perfectly complement the game's various environments and moods.
The album comprises 30 tracks, each offering a unique sonic experience. From the ambient and atmospheric "Ki" and "Alpha" to the more upbeat and rhythmic "Moog City 2" and "Biome Fest," the album showcases C418's versatility and mastery of electronic music. The tracks are meticulously crafted, with intricate layers of synths, beats, and melodies that create a rich and immersive soundscape.
"Minecraft - Volume Beta" was originally self-released by C418 and later made available on platforms like Bandcamp, Apple Music, and Spotify. It has since been physically released by record label Ghostly, making it accessible to fans in various formats, including vinyl and CD. The album has garnered critical acclaim and has been praised for its ability to enhance the gaming experience, as well as its standalone appeal as a piece of electronic music.

About C418
C418, the musical alter ego of German composer Daniel Rosenfeld, has carved out a unique niche in the world of electronic and ambient music. Renowned for his minimalistic and soothing compositions, C418 gained global recognition as the original composer and sound designer for the iconic sandbox video game Minecraft. His work for the game, particularly the "Minecraft - Volume Alpha" and "Minecraft - Volume Beta" soundtracks, is celebrated for its nostalgic charm and relaxing qualities, earning it a place among the greatest video game soundtracks of all time. Rosenfeld's journey began with chiptune music created on the Schism Tracker program, showcasing his deep love and dedication to music. Beyond his gaming contributions, C418's discography offers a rich tapestry of ambient and electronic tracks that continue to captivate fans worldwide.
